    Beaver hats that were felted from beaver fur exclusively were termed castor. If the hat was partially beaver fur and partially some other type of fur, they earned the term demi-castor. Further confusing the issue, the hat would also be named based on its shape. On 1stDibs, find a collection of authentic beaver hats from some of the world’s top sellers.

    While artists can wear any type of headwear, the most famous type of artist's hat is called a beret. Usually crafted out of felt or wool, a beret is a round, flexible hat first worn in the 18th century in Basque, the border area between Spain and France. Its association with artists comes largely from Pablo Picasso, who was frequently photographed wearing one. On 1stDibs, find a selection of berets.

    What those Italian hats are called depends on their style. Perhaps the type of headwear most frequently associated with Italy is the Coppola. Although this wool flat cap with a rigid brim originated in England, Sicilians and Calabrians became enamored with them in the early 20th century and the hats have remained popular since. Other hats traditionally worn in Italy include the beret and the Panama hat, though, like the Coppola, these hats have international origins, coming from France and Ecuador, respectively.     The cloche hat was first created in 1908 by Caroline Reboux and was immediately adopted as a favorite for many women. The shape of a bell was the inspiration and why the French word for bell, cloche, was chosen for the hat. This style of chapeau had its heyday in the 1920 to-30s when flappers and film stars everywhere donned a cloche and showed off their style.
